Output 4852334f24de3a77c33053230ce2f69c986861e624eb2905ee0cca926e7680b8:1

value
44550177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f386c5782007321228f975f3b2990fc1ba5795 OP_EQUAL
address
3DiiBBra4PMaixLtNdsMZ34jbZPJQUxtQa
transaction
4852334f24de3a77c33053230ce2f69c986861e624eb2905ee0cca926e7680b8
spent
true